BMWs M division first started in 1978 when the first official M-badged car, the M1, went on sale to the public. It didnt start well but it got the name M out there. Popularity exploded in 1979 with the release of the M5, which was a high performance version of BMWs popular 5 Series mid-size saloon car. Since then, all high performance saloons have been judged against BMWs M cars & the BMW M3 is one of the best of the breed. The M3 has a 3.2 litre engine putting out 343 bhp. It will go from 0-60mph in 4.8 seconds & on to a top speed, which is limited to 155mph, although it is claimed that it will do 184mph unlimited! This is your chance to drive a future classic. What is Bobsleigh? Put simply, it's two or four members trying to get a bobsleigh down to the bottom of an icey track as quick as possible. It begins by pushing the bob off the start & everyone quickly getting in. This is the most important part of the run as a lot of time can be lost. During an Olympic run the bob can achieve speeds approaching 90mph & the passengers can pull up to 6g in the corners! The same as Formula 1 cars! Once in, the crew keep their heads down, forming a compact surface with minimum drag until they reach the end, when they can finally catch their breath.
